Quick-defrost programme ( )
With this special defrost programme, the microwave starts at a high power setting, which is
then gradually reduced in order to ensure that the core of the frozen food is also defrosted.
For delicate food, the setting '
Low
' (see table '
Power settings / Overview
') is recommended.
This setting ensures that delicate food is defrosted slowly and evenly. The defrosting time
must be set in the display.
For defrosting raw or previously cooked food, a defrosting time of approximately 5 minutes
for each 450g is appropriate, e.g. it should take about 5 minutes to defrost 450g of frozen
spaghetti sauce. The defrosting time can be pre-set to a maximum of 45 minutes.
Helpful notes:
- The defrosting process should be interrupted at regular intervals and those food portions
already defrosted should be taken out; this is to ensure that food already defrosted will
not take away heat from food that still requires defrosting.
- Should the food not be completely defrosted after the pre-set defrosting time has
elapsed, it is advisable to limit any further defrosting times to 1-minute periods until the
food is fully defrosted.
- Food stored in plastic containers or wrapped in plastic should be left standing for a while
after it has been taken from the freezer. Wait until the food can be easily detached from
the plastic, before it is put into the oven inside a container suitable for use with
microwave ovens.

Setting multiple programmes
The unit may be set for a maximum of 3 programmes running consecutively, e.g. defrosting,
followed by microwave and then hot-air cooking. Any defrosting, microwave, grill or hot-air
programmes as well as the combination of the programmes may be selected. Any quick-
defrosting programme must of course run before any cooking programme can be started.
